Output efcbcecf41ebf04f3276e61794fbcfc2df26da43ca0ff653217d5ae8a71e2f60:0

value
787839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4812a53a92944d0c4550a9c401c2ed413ecbbabf OP_EQUAL
address
38G6uryKEMWoJoYdyM1iZizgY7t7EfAJ1h
transaction
efcbcecf41ebf04f3276e61794fbcfc2df26da43ca0ff653217d5ae8a71e2f60
confirmations
195401
spent
true